Fullstack Todo List هو تطبيق ويب تفاعلي لإدارة المهام، يعتمد على React وTypeScript في الواجهة الأمامية، مع Strapi كـ Headless CMS للواجهة الخلفية.
المميزات:
إدارة المهام بسهولة: إضافة، تعديل، وحذف المهام بواجهة سلسة.
مصادقة المستخدم: تسجيل الدخول والتسجيل الآمن.
تصميم متجاوب: يعمل على مختلف الأجهزة (موبايل وكمبيوتر).
React Query: لتحسين جلب البيانات والتخزين المؤقت.
تحسين تجربة المستخدم: تحميل بيانات متقدم ورسائل خطأ مخصصة.
التقنيات المستخدمة:
الواجهة الأمامية: React, TypeScript, Tailwind CSS
الواجهة الخلفية: Strapi
إدارة الحالة: React Hooks, React Query
أدوات التطوير: Vite, ESLint